Phenotypes Associated with This Genotype
Genotype
MGI:4939894
Allelic
Composition
Rassf5tm1Kina/Rassf5tm1Kina
Genetic
Background
B6.Cg-Rassf5tm1Kina
Find Mice Using the International Mouse Strain Resource (IMSR)
Mouse lines carrying:
Rassf5tm1Kina mutation (0 available); any Rassf5 mutation (26 available)
phenotype observed in females
phenotype observed in males
N normal phenotype
immune system
• total B and T cells are increased by about 50%
• CD138+B220+ plasma cells are increased in 10 month old female mutants
• total B and T cells are increased by about 50%
• CD44+CD62L- effector-memory T cells are increased in 10 month old female mutants
• lymphocyte hyperproliferation, with lymphocytes exhibiting enhanced S phase entry after stimulation
• primary B cells exhibit accelearated S phase entry after stimulation
• primary T cells exhibit accelerated S phase entry after stimulation
• aged mice exhibit a 2-fold increase in serum IgG compared to wild-type mice
• deposits of IgG and C3 in the kidney
• aged mice exhibit high titers of antibodies to dsDNA
• females exhibit evidence of glomerulonephritis by 10 months of age while males show similar phenotypes at a later age of 15-18 months

neoplasm
• mutants develop hepatocellular carcinomas after 1.5 years of age
• mutants develop B220+CD19+ diffuse large B cell lymphomas
• about 30% of mutants develop B cell lymphomas in peripheral lymph nodes and spleen at 1 year of age
• lymphomas are IgM+, IgD+, CD21+, CD23+, and mature B cell type; progressed lymphomas often lose these markers
• lymphomas are monoclonal or oligoclonal in origin
• B cell lymphomas are not related to severity of autoimmune phenotypes
• mutants develop lung adenocarcinomas after 1.5 years of age
